The Denials & Appeals Specialist is responsible for reviewing, correcting, and appealing denied claims as well as performing accounts receivable (AR) follow-up to ensure accurate and timely reimbursement. This role helps reduce preventable denials, improve collections, and support overall revenue cycle performance.

  • Review denied claims and determine appropriate follow-up action.
  • Prepare and submit appeals with complete documentation.
  • Correct and resubmit claims as necessary to resolve errors.
  • Perform AR follow-up on outstanding accounts, including contacting payers and resolving adjudication issues.
  • Work high-dollar and aging accounts with priority to prevent write-offs.
  • Document all follow-up and appeal activity clearly in the billing system.
  • Identify denial and AR trends and communicate findings to the Billing Manager.
  • Collaborate with the RCM Analyst on denial and aging reports.
  • Coordinate with Patient Access and UR regarding eligibility- or authorization-related denials.
  • Other duties as assigned.
